PRR 3005, E-3SD, 1941         
Here is a photo via Harold K. Vollrath that was taken in West Philadelphia, in November of 1941. Shown here is Pennsylvania Railroad engine #3005, an E-3SD (4-4-2) "Atlantic" built in Juniata as an E-3D during 1906, rebuilt as an E-3SD, and retired in May of 1947 after 31 years of faithful service. Note the Hostler up by the locomotive's bell. Gary Mittner Collection.
